Chicken-Fried Steak

Prep: 15 min Cook: 60 min Serves: 6 Cuisine: American

Ingredients

  • 1 1/2 lb beef top round steak, 1/2-inch thick
  • 1 Tbsp milk
  • 1 beaten egg
  • 1 cup fine soda cracker crumbs
  • 1/4 cup salad oil

Instructions

  1. Pound the steak to 1/4-inch thickness and cut into serving pieces.
  2. Blend the beaten egg with milk.
  3. Dip each piece of meat into the egg mixture, then coat with cracker crumbs.
  4. Slowly brown the meat in hot salad oil, turning once.
  5. Cover and cook on low heat for 45 to 60 minutes until tender.
  6. Season to taste before serving.
